Kabob Grill N' Go is a family-owned restaurant built on Mediterranean and Armenian recipes passed down through generations, with what the kitchen describes as a bit of southwestern flair worked in. Meats are prepared daily and charbroiled over a mesquite wood flame — beef koobideh, beef barg, chicken tenders, chicken thighs, and pork ribs anchor the combo plates, each served with basmati rice, shirazi salad, grilled vegetables, and a choice of dip.
The restaurant also caters events, building multi-course spreads from the same grilled proteins and sides for larger parties.
Phoenix New Times named it among the city's best restaurants of 2025. Regulars point to standout food and service, though the kitchen's daily-prepared supply means popular cuts can run out.
